The Company: This market leading Insurance broker based in Central Bristol are looking to appoint a Junior Account Handler to join their commercial team. This is an excellent opportunity to get a foot in the door with a company that can offer ongoing training and development.

Specific Duties Will Include:

  • Servicing your own dedicated book of clients
  • Managing renewals
  • Handling mid-term adjustments
  • Addressing any client queries

The Candidate: The successful applicant will have some previous experience within the insurance sector (either personal lines or commercial) and a desire to pursue a career in this field.

Salary/Benefits Information:

  • Basic salary of up to £33,000 p.a. depending on experience
  • Competitive internal benefits
  • Generous pension contribution and holiday allowance
